James E. Gagnon, 74, of 1823 Lyndale Ave., Eau Claire, died Sunday, June 16, 2002 at his home. He was born on March 1, 1928 in Two Rivers, WI to Norman and Martha (Statler) Gagnon. Jim graduated from Two Rivers High School and lettered in both football and swimming.\r\nHe enlisted in the U.S. Army on July 17, 1946, served with the Military Police in Japan, and was honorably discharged on May 21, 1948. Jim attended UW-Madison graduating with a degree in economics in 1952. He married Monica Walter on August 2, 1952 at St. Patrick's Church in Eau Claire. Jim was a sales representative at Walter Brewing Company and Land O'Lakes, and later an insurance agent until his retirement.\r\nJim was a member of the Eau Claire Lions Club for over twenty years. His interests included woodworking, oil painting, remodeling and watching Notre Dame Football.\r\nSurvivors include his wife of 50 years, Monica; seven children, James (Paula) of Eau Claire, Mary Ellen Gagnon of Poynette, Paul of Los Angeles, CA, Robert (Justin) of Santa Monica, CA, Peter (Nidy Scott) of Palmdale, CA, Michael (Jennifer) of Maui, HI and Patrick (Ida Yellowman) of Puyallup, WA; ten grandchildren; brother, Mark (Alice) Gagnon of Manitowoc; two aunts, Bernice Flynn and Mary Statler both of Townsend, WI; and many nieces and nephews.\r\nHe was preceded in death by his parents; a son, David M.
